April Mae Hendricks was born in Monroe County, MS, on April 15, 1973, and was raised in the Prairie Community. From a young age, she demonstrated a compassionate spirit, loving to care for the elderly. She accepted Christ at the age of nine and was baptized at Baptist Grove Church, where she found joy in attending and serving her church community.
In her journey through life, April moved to Columbus, where she became a beloved member of her community. She worked diligently at several local businesses, including The Palmer Home, Chevron, and most recently as a shift leader at McDonald's. Her friendly demeanor and dedication made her a cherished colleague and friend to many.
April was known for her vibrant personality, her love of fashion, her passion for cooking, and her beautiful voice singing gospel music. Above all, she treasured her family and the memories they shared. She married Darren Hendricks in 2013, and together they built a life filled with love, laughter, and countless moments for over 29 years.
April Mae Hendricks, affectionately known as "Abby," transitioned peacefully on May 29, 2025, in Baldwyn, Mississippi. She was preceded in death by her parents; her brother, Tony Strong, and her beloved daughter,
Left to cherish her memories are her loving husband, Darren Hendricks; her children, Courtney (Porscha) Parson, Marcus Parson, Raven Parson, and Darreana Hendricks; her three sisters, Vanessa (Charles) Williams, Virginia (Marlon) Spencer, Odessa Vasser; and her brother, James (Maggie) Parson; her seven grandchildren; as well as many other relatives and friends who loved her dearly.
April's legacy of kindness, faith, and love will forever remain in the hearts of those she touched. Her spirit will continue to inspire and her memory will be a guiding light for all who knew her.
